Factor 360 Design & Technology

1141 Deadwood Ave # 4 57702-0392 Rapid City South Dakota USA
  • Profile: Factor 360 Design & Technology is a Advertising company located at Rapid City, South Dakota USA, address is 1141 Deadwood Ave # 4, Rapid City 57702-0392 SD, postcode is 57702-0392, you can contact Factor 360 Design & Technology by phone 6053439014
Please share as much information as you can about Factor 360 Design & Technology so other users can benefit from your comment.